Intex Aqua G2 Entry-Level Android Smartphone Launched at Rs. 1,990

Intex on Wednesday unveiled its new budget Aqua G2 smartphone in India. Priced at Rs. 1,990, the Intex Aqua G2 is targeted at first time smartphone buyers.

The Aqua G2 features 2G connectivity and comes with a 2.8-inch TFT display with a screen resolution of 240x320 pixels. The smartphone runs Android 4.2.2 Jelly Bean and supports dual-SIMs. The device packs an 1100mAh battery that can offer a talk time of up to 5 hours and a standby time of up to 6 days. It sport a 0.3-megapixel front and rear cameras. The rear camera comes accompanied with an LED flash. The Aqua G2 is powered by a single-core processor coupled with 256MB of RAM and packs 512MB of inbuilt storage. It supports expandable storage via microSD card (up to 16GB). It measures 105x57.4x11mm and will be available in Grey and Champagne colours. Unfortunately, there is no 3G support on the handset.

The company says that the Aqua G2 will come with preloaded apps such as Opera mini.

Commenting on the launch, Sanjay Kumar Kalirona, Mobile Business Head, Intex Technologies said, "With Aqua G2, we are targeting feature phone users who are yet to switch to smartphones. Aqua G2 is a brilliant device having all the required features, performance capability for any first-time user to get the smartphone experience. We are confident that Aqua G2 at such affordable price point will further enhance our market share and tap the potential feature phone consumers."
